Disney has teamed up with Minecraft to build an entire virtual Magic Kingdom park that your Minecraft character can visit!

In celebration of Disney World’s 50th Anniversary, the Walt Disney World Magic Kingdom Adventure downloadable content pack is now available for purchase from the Minecraft Marketplace. Note, you’ll need to have the Minecraft game itself in order to play this. We found the Minecraft app itself on the Apple App Store for $6.99. You can also purchase Minecraft for your computer or other devices.

Once you’ve downloaded Minecraft and then downloaded the Magic Kingdom Adventure pack, you can have an entire theme park at your fingertips.

Inside the Minecraft version of Magic Kingdom, your character can actually ride more than 20 different attractions including Big Thunder Mountain Railroad, Space Mountain, Haunted Mansion, Jungle Cruise, Mad Tea Cups, and “it’s a small world.”

You can compete with other characters on Buzz Lightyear Space Ranger Spin, just like you do in real life!

The six themed lands are all available to visit, including Adventureland, Frontierland, Fantasyland, Tomorrowland, Liberty Square, and Main Street, U.S.A.

Your character can meet 25 different Disney and Pixar characters, and you can collect their autographs in a virtual book. You can even buy souvenirs in the game, like spirit jerseys and Mickey ears, plus you can get iconic snacks like DOLE Whips!

There are 25 different character skins to choose from as well, including Mickey and Minnie Mouse, characters from Winnie the Pooh, Hitchhiking Ghosts, and more. There are even character skins for Mickey and Minnie in their special 50th Anniversary outfits.
